Transaction 753a8845e8238189c0704502dd3d3d55e0801709cfe69f1cc5d33421825de284
1 Input
1 Output
-
753a8845e8238189c0704502dd3d3d55e0801709cfe69f1cc5d33421825de284:0
- value
- 83896
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6aab7a32c60551e0110048ae5bc6ee816b9f31bc OP_EQUAL
- address
- 3BR2yLDFVB2yaQTAThy5uF8euxz9GGpXmm